We are looking for a skilled and detail-oriented Instrument Technician to join our team. The ideal candidate will be responsible for installing, calibrating, maintaining, and repairing a wide range of instrumentation and control systems used in industrial and manufacturing environments. This role requires a strong understanding of electronics, pneumatics, and process control systems, as well as the ability to troubleshoot complex equipment and ensure optimal performance.
As an Instrument Technician, you will work closely with engineers, maintenance teams, and operations personnel to ensure that all instrumentation systems are functioning correctly and efficiently. You will be expected to interpret technical drawings and manuals, perform routine inspections, and document all maintenance activities. Your work will directly impact the safety, efficiency, and productivity of our operations.
Key responsibilities include installing new instruments, calibrating sensors and transmitters, diagnosing faults, and performing preventive maintenance. You will also be responsible for ensuring compliance with industry standards and safety regulations. The role may involve working in hazardous environments, so adherence to safety protocols is essential.
The successful candidate will have a strong background in instrumentation technology, excellent problem-solving skills, and the ability to work independently or as part of a team. A certification or associate degree in instrumentation, electronics, or a related field is typically required, along with relevant work experience in an industrial setting.

Responsibilities
Text copied to clipboard!- Install and configure instrumentation and control systems
- Calibrate sensors, transmitters, and other measurement devices
- Perform routine maintenance and inspections
- Troubleshoot and repair faulty instrumentation equipment
- Document maintenance and repair activities
- Ensure compliance with safety and industry standards
- Assist in system upgrades and modifications
- Collaborate with engineers and maintenance teams
- Interpret technical drawings and manuals
- Maintain inventory of tools and spare parts
